Abstract:

The development and deployment of emerging technologies poses a threat to the Rule of Law. From autonomous vehicles to geoengineering and, now, artificial intelligence, emerging technologies have the potential to improve as well as impair the Rule of Law. Generative Al tools, for example, can assist pro se litigants with legal research, thereby increasing individuals’ abilities to defend themselves fully and forcefully in court.
